js是一种脚本语言,注释:单行注释//内容,多行注释/*内容*/
一、标识符
标识符是变量、函数、属性的名字,或者函数的参数。
命名规则:
1.由字母、数字、下划线(_)或者美元($)组成
2.不能以数字开头
3.不能使用关键字,保留字作为标识符
二、编写样式
1.内部样式
2.外部样式
三、变量
用来临时存储信息,区分类型,但没有int之类的关键字
创建方法:var x=1; var x=2,name="zhangsan";
var x; x=1; var name; name="lisi";
四、调试
alert()弹框调试、console.log控制台输出调试
五、自定义函数
自定义函数和内置函数,是完成某一个功能模块的代码段,可以重复执行,方便管理和维护。
创建方式:
1.函数声明,先使用后定义
2.函数表达式,先定义后使用
六、数据类型
(一)简单数据类型
1.undefined:一般指的是已经声明,但是没有赋值的变量,派生自null值,undefined==null ----> 返回的是true
2.null:空对象类型,var a = null; 和 var a = "";有区别;
3.boolean:布尔类型,只有true和false 2种值
4.number:数字类型,整型、浮点型都包括
5.string:字符串类型,必须放在单引号或者双引号中
(二)特殊类型
1.object -- 对象类型,在js中常见的window document array等
2.NaN -- 是Number的一种